L<strong>in</strong>dy Sando and Vaughan Taylor began their careers <strong>in</strong> <strong>architectural</strong> <strong>glass</strong> after tra<strong>in</strong><strong>in</strong>g<br />

with master sta<strong>in</strong>ed <strong>glass</strong> artisan Leonard Mathews. In 1976 they established the Art Glass<br />

studio together. They cont<strong>in</strong>ue to work together fulltime and have completed hundreds of<br />

commissions for homes, churches and public build<strong>in</strong>gs.<br />

They have exhibited <strong>in</strong> Australia and Japan. In 1986 they were recipients of a shared grant<br />

to mount an exhibition of <strong>architectural</strong> sta<strong>in</strong>ed <strong>glass</strong> at the Jam Factory <strong>in</strong> Adelaide. They<br />

cont<strong>in</strong>ue to forge new ground and endeavour to take the <strong>glass</strong> <strong>in</strong>dustry to a higher level of<br />

expression. They are currently work<strong>in</strong>g from their studio <strong>in</strong> the Adelaide hills.<br />

Sando has studied many art related courses <strong>in</strong>clud<strong>in</strong>g commercial art, design, life draw<strong>in</strong>g,<br />

pr<strong>in</strong>tmak<strong>in</strong>g and sculpture. She has also participated <strong>in</strong> numerous <strong>glass</strong> workshops with<br />

<strong>in</strong>ternational designers <strong>in</strong>clud<strong>in</strong>g Ludwig Schaffrath, Johannes Schreiter, Lutz Haufschild<br />

and Amber Hiscott. She designs all of the <strong>glass</strong>works that the studio produces and is<br />

responsible for surface treatments <strong>in</strong>clud<strong>in</strong>g pa<strong>in</strong>t<strong>in</strong>g and etch<strong>in</strong>g. Sando is keen<br />

to develop new <strong>techniques</strong> and solutions <strong>in</strong> her work. She is currently experiment<strong>in</strong>g with<br />

<strong>contemporary</strong> pa<strong>in</strong>ted <strong>techniques</strong> on commercial <strong>glass</strong>. She was a found<strong>in</strong>g member of<br />

Aus<strong>glass</strong> and was a member of CraftSouth for many years.<br />

Taylor fabricates all of the w<strong>in</strong>dows and <strong>glass</strong>works made by the Art Glass Studio.<br />

He comes from a practical background and has a very hands on approach. He is<br />

constantly develop<strong>in</strong>g new ideas and build<strong>in</strong>g the equipment to produce them. He<br />

has been experiment<strong>in</strong>g with <strong>glass</strong> lam<strong>in</strong>ation <strong>techniques</strong> for many years and was very<br />

<strong>in</strong>terested to see what was happen<strong>in</strong>g <strong>in</strong> this area overseas. The utilization of commercial<br />

glaz<strong>in</strong>g technology to achieve <strong>glass</strong> designs is another area he is develop<strong>in</strong>g. Taylor is a<br />

member of the Glass and Glaz<strong>in</strong>g Guild of S.A.<br />
